Calcium Lactate 10 Grams (648 mg)
Rugby Calcium Lactate 10 Grams (648 mg) is a simple mineral supplement, providing calcium in a lactate form. This product achieved an N+ Score of 53, resulting in an 'F' grade, indicating a below-average quality assessment. Each 3-tablet serving delivers 252 mg of elemental Calcium, which is considered to be at a clinically relevant dosage for supporting bone health. With only one total ingredient, the product boasts excellent label transparency at 100%. However, its formula completeness score is low at 25%, reflecting its singular focus. This supplement may be beneficial for individuals specifically looking to supplement their calcium intake, particularly those who may not be meeting daily requirements through diet alone.
